//
// main.cpp
// 資料型別與表示式
//// created by mac on 15-2-16.
//#include
//int main(int argc, const char * argv)
/*//三個數的排序
using namespace std;
void sortthree(int x,int y,int z)else if(x>z)else if (y>z)
}int main()
*///const 關鍵字在定義變數時,如果在前面加上const,則在程式執行期間不能改變,這種變數稱為常變數或者唯讀變數
const
inta=3;
//該變數的值不能改變,始終為3;常變數不能出現等號的左邊
#define mac 234
//符號常量
//自增運算子++ --
usingnamespace
std;
int main(void)
//符號常量和常變數的區別符號常量只是用乙個符號代替乙個字串,在預編譯把所有符號變數替換為所指定的字串,它沒有型別,在記憶體中並不存在以符號常量命名的儲存單元。而常變數具有變數的特徵,它具有型別,在記憶體中存在以它命名的儲存的單元,可以用sizeof運算子測出長度。它與一般變數的唯一不同時,是指定的變數不可以改變。
資料型別和表示式
一 整型資料儲存格式 1 整形資料在記憶體中是以補碼形式儲存的。2 整數的原碼,反碼,補碼相同,符號位是0,其餘各位表示數值。3 負數的原碼,反碼和補碼不同。原碼 符號位為1,其餘各位表示數值的絕對值。反碼 符號位為1,其餘各位對原碼取反。補碼 反碼末位加1。上面說的都是有符號的整數,而無符號整數不...
C語言資料型別和表示式
基本資料型別最主要的特點就,其值不可以再分解為其它型別。也就是說,基本資料型別是自我說明的。常量在程式執行過程中,其值不發生改變的量。在c語言中用乙個識別符號來表示,所以又叫作符號常量。公式 define 識別符號 常量 eg define pi 3.1415926 其中 define也是一條預處理...
C 基本資料型別和表示式
c 是一種靜態型別語言 執行前指定每個資料的型別 也是一種強型別語言 對資料的操作進行嚴格的型別檢查 bool型別資料在算術運算時true對應1,false對應0。typedef給已有型別取別名 typedef 已有型別 別名 常量包括兩種 字面常量和符號常量。字面常量 直接寫出來的 符號常量 又稱...